A certain volume of oxygen diffused from a given apparatus in 125 seconds. In the same conditions , the same volume of gas N, diffused in 100 seconds . Calculate the relative molecular mass of N(=16.0).

rate oxygen = V/125 s
rate N gas = V/100 s
molar mass O2 = 32
molar mass N = ?
mm stands for molar mass
(rate 1)/(rate 2) = sqrt (mm N/mm O2)
(V/125)/(V/100) = sqrt (mm N/32)
Solve for molar mass N.
